Victorian Sterling Silver Cow Creamer by Samuel Landeck, London, 1892
Victorian Sterling Silver Cow Creamer by Samuel Landeck, London, 1892

Victorian Sterling Silver Cow Creamer by Samuel Landeck, London, 1892

Located in Jesmond, Newcastle Upon Tyne

An exceptional, fine and impressive antique Victorian English sterling silver cow creamer; an addition to our 19th Century silverware collection. This exceptional antique Victorian sterling silver creamer has been realistically modelled in the form of a cow. The plain body of this antique silver creamer is embellished with details reproducing the fine definition of the cow's facial and anatomical features. The jug is fitted with a hinged cover, surmounted with an impressive cast and applied finial realistically modelled in the form of a fly. This impressive Victorian silver cow creamer is fitted with a loop handle, modelled in the form of the cow's tail. The hallmarks to the underside and hind leg of this cow creamer include: Maker's mark: SBL (Samuel Boyce (or Boaz) Landeck) British assay mark: Leopard head (London, England) Silver quality/purity mark: British lion passant mark, 930, Dutch lion rampant mark with 1st standard purity (minimum .934, 934/1000)* Export mark: Key mark intruding lion passant Additional mark: F (foreign manufacture mark) Such antique Dutch sterling silver examples are becoming increasingly difficult to locate. * The country of origin hallmarked this item with the standard mark 930/lion rampant mark and once imported into Britain the silver purity was tested and hallmarks struck reaffirming the silver is a minimum of sterling standard. Victorian Sterling Silver Canteen of Cutlery for Twelve Persons
Victorian Sterling Silver Canteen of Cutlery for Twelve Persons

Victorian Sterling Silver Canteen of Cutlery for Twelve Persons

By William Eaton

Located in Jesmond, Newcastle Upon Tyne

An exceptional, fine and impressive antique Victorian English sterling silver composite Fiddle & Thread pattern flatware service for 12 persons; an addition to our canteen of cutlery collection The pieces of this exceptional, antique Victorian composite sterling silver flatware service for twelve persons have been crafted in the Fiddle and Thread pattern. The surface of each handle is embellished with a paralleling thread decorated border. The anterior surface of each handle terminal is ornamented with a contemporary bright cut engraved crest of a stag's head erased. The posterior surface of each piece is plain and unembellished, apart from a rounded heel to the bowl of each spoon and drop of each fork. This Victorian sterling silver flatware set consists of 66 pieces: 24 Table forks 12 Table spoons 12 Dessert forks 12 Dessert spoons 6 Serving spoons These exceptional example of antique silverware have been crafted by the collectable silversmiths William Eaton (in 1839-1841) and Elizabeth Eaton (in 1852). Vintage Sterling Silver and Enamel Salt and Pepper Set
Vintage Sterling Silver and Enamel Salt and Pepper Set

Vintage Sterling Silver and Enamel Salt and Pepper Set

Located in Jesmond, Newcastle Upon Tyne

An exceptional, fine and impressive, pair of vintage English cast sterling silver and enamel salt and pepper set, in the form of a soft boiled egg in an egg holder - boxed; an addition to our silver cruets or condiments collection. These exceptional vintage Elizabeth II sterling silver condiment set consists of a salt Shaker, a pepper Shaker and two spoons. The pieces of this silver and enamel salt and pepper set have been realistically modelled in the form of soft boiled eggs in egg cups. Each condiment Shaker is ornamented with an enamel eggshell design with the top portion 'cracked' away to reveal the pierced salt and pepper holes; the upper portion of the pepper retains the original gilding. The enamel and silver egg covers detach from a bayonet style fitment to a brown enamel decorated egg cup; once the cover is removed it can be determined the pieces were commissioned to be used as functional egg cups. The spoons have circular rounded bowls to plain waisted stems and terminate with cast finials encircled with scalloped borders and circular motifs, accented with initial 'M' to one and 'N' to the other. These vintage silver and enamel salt and pepper set are fitted to the original hinged crimson leatherette presentation box, with a velvet and satin lined interior and secures with two hinged catches.
